在云计算时代,利用云免服务器集群可以为各种应用提供强大的计算能力。本文将介绍如何快速启动并管理10台节点的云免服务器集群。
准备工作
在开始之前,确保已经选择了一个合适的云服务提供商,并创建了至少10个可用的实例或虚拟机。还需安装好必要的软件工具如SSH客户端、Ansible等,以便于后续管理和配置工作。
节点初始化
对于每个节点,首先需要进行基本的系统设置,包括但不限于:
- 更新操作系统和内核;
- 配置静态IP地址(如果适用);
- 安装必要的依赖包,如Python、Java等;
- 禁用防火墙或配置允许通过的端口;
- 创建一个非root用户用于日常操作。
以上步骤可以通过编写脚本或者使用自动化工具来批量完成,以提高效率。
集群构建
当所有节点都准备好后,接下来就是构建集群环境。这里推荐使用开源项目Kubernetes作为容器编排平台,因为它能够很好地支持大规模集群管理。具体做法如下:
- 在一台主控节点上部署Kubernetes master组件;
- 在其余九个工作节点上部署Kubernetes node组件;
- 确保所有节点之间网络互通,并且可以从主控节点访问到各个工作节点;
- 根据实际需求定义Pods、Services、Deployments等资源对象。
完成上述配置后,一个初步具备功能性的云免服务器集群就建立起来了。
日常运维
为了保证集群稳定运行,在日常运维过程中需要注意以下几点:
- 定期检查节点健康状态,及时处理故障报警信息;
- 监控集群资源使用情况,合理调整任务调度策略;
- 备份重要数据,防止意外丢失;
- 关注安全漏洞公告,及时升级相关组件版本。
还可以借助Prometheus、Grafana等工具实现对集群性能指标的可视化展示,从而更直观地掌握整个系统的运作状况。
通过合理的规划与实施,我们可以轻松地在一个小时内完成10台节点规模的云免服务器集群的搭建工作。而在后续的维护中,则要不断优化和完善各项机制,使其能够更好地服务于业务发展。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/45014.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。